The Page of Cups brings an energy of emotional openness and innocent wonder, while the Two of Swords speaks to a crossroads where heart and mind seem at odds. In matters of love, you may find yourself receiving or offering tender gestures, yet feeling uncertain about which direction to take. This combination suggests a beautiful tension between feeling deeply and thinking clearly about your romantic path. The emotional messenger of the Page encourages you to stay receptive to new feelings, while the Two of Swords reminds you that some decisions require both intuition and careful consideration. Trust that this period of emotional questioning is preparing you for deeper authentic connection.
Your professional landscape reveals the interplay between creative inspiration and strategic decision-making. The Page of Cups encourages you to approach your work with fresh eyes and emotional intelligence, perhaps bringing innovative ideas or a more heart-centered approach to your responsibilities. Meanwhile, the Two of Swords indicates you're facing a significant choice that requires you to balance multiple perspectives or competing priorities. This pairing suggests that your next career move may involve integrating your intuitive gifts with logical analysis. The key lies in not rushing the decision, but allowing both your emotional wisdom and rational mind to inform your path forward.
Your spiritual journey is currently navigating the sacred space between feeling and knowing, between receptivity and discernment. The Page of Cups invites you to remain open to spiritual messages and synchronicities that may arrive through unexpected channels or gentle whispers. The Two of Swords, however, suggests you're being called to develop your inner discrimination - learning to discern which spiritual insights truly serve your highest good. This combination speaks to a time of spiritual apprenticeship where you're learning to trust both your emotional receptivity and your developing wisdom. Your spiritual path is asking you to honor both the innocence of the seeker and the responsibility of conscious choice.
You stand at a threshold where emotional authenticity meets conscious decision-making, and this intersection holds profound wisdom for your growth. The Page of Cups reminds you that staying open to new feelings and perspectives is essential, even when uncertainty feels uncomfortable. The Two of Swords suggests that this period of weighing options is not a sign of weakness, but rather a necessary pause that allows deeper clarity to emerge. Consider that the tension between feeling and thinking may actually be preparing you for a more integrated approach to life's challenges. Trust that by honoring both your emotional truth and your need for careful consideration, you're developing the inner resources necessary for authentic living.
